Ink Stick Case
  • Nationality/Period

    Joseon Dynasty

  • Materials

    Wood

  • Category

    Industry·Occupation - Manufacturing industry - Carpentry - Ink pad

  • Dimensions

    H. 10.5cm, L. 27.7cm, W. 11.3cm

  • Accession Number

    Gu 1039

Ink stick cases such as this one were used by carpenters and stone masons during the late Joseon Period. It consists of two parts, one of which served to contain ink-soaked cotton, the other to contain a spool of ink strings. A decorative carving of a turtle fills the space between the two parts.
